Kokrajhar, February 17: The Bodoland Territorial Council (BTC) today unanimously passed a resolution for creation of a separate Bodoland state carved out of Assam.
In the ongoing budget session, the BTC unanimously passed the resolution, adopted unopposed, which was announced by Emmanuel Moshahary, executive member of the Council.
“It is unanimously felt by all the people of Bodoland that the contentious issues can be resolved only by creation of a separate Bodoland state”, the resolution said.
The resolution alleged the state has not been allocating annual plan fund to the BTC at the fixed ratio on the basis of its population and central funds are not directed to BTC straightaway.
The BTC in the resolution considered “strongly the central government’s policy towards creation of new states as Telengana carved out of Andhra Pradesh”.
